BackgroundIn the Gambling Disorder (GD), there is no exogenous drug administration that acts as the central core of the traditional meaning of addiction. A specific psychopathology of Substance Use Disorders has been proposed recently. In a sample of Heroin Use Disorder (HUD) patients entering opioid agonist treatment, it became possible to identify a group of 5 mutually exclusive psychiatric dimensions: Worthlessness-Being trapped (W-BT), Somatic Symptoms (SS), Sensitivity-Psychoticism (SP), Panic Anxiety (PA) and Violence-Suicide (VS). The specificity of these dimensions was suggested by the absence of their correlations with treatment choice, active substance use, psychiatric comorbidity and the principal substance of abuse and by the opportunity, through their use, of fully discriminating HUD from Major Depression patients and, partially, from obese non-psychiatric patients. To further support this specificity in the present study, we tested the feasibility of discriminating HUD patients from those affected by a non-substance-related addictive behaviour, such as GD. In this way, we also investigated the psychopathological peculiarities of GD patients.
机译:背景技术在赌博疾病(GD)中,没有任何外来药物管理可作为成瘾传统含义的核心。最近已经提出了一种物质使用障碍的特殊心理病理学。在接受阿片类激动剂治疗的海洛因使用障碍(HUD)患者的样本中,有可能识别出一组5个相互排斥的精神病学维度:身世被困(W-BT),躯体症状(SS),敏感性精神病( SP),恐慌症(PA)和暴力自杀(VS)。这些维度的特殊性是由于它们与治疗选择,活性物质使用,精神病合并症和滥用的主要物质之间没有相关性,以及通过使用它们有机会将HUD与严重抑郁症患者完全区分开,部分地来自肥胖的非精神病患者。为了在本研究中进一步支持这种特异性,我们测试了将HUD患者与受非物质相关成瘾行为(例如GD)影响的患者进行区分的可行性。通过这种方式,我们还研究了GD患者的心理病理特点。
